云服务器连接超时怎么办

# 云服务器连接超时怎么办

在现代互联网环境中,云服务器成为了各类业务的重要基础设施。然而,连接超时的现象在使用云服务器时时有发生。这可能会导致业务中断,影响用户体验,因此处理连接超时的问题显得尤为重要。本文将深入探讨云服务器连接超时的原因、排查方法以及解决方案,帮助用户高效应对这一问题。

## 一、云服务器连接超时的常见原因

连接超时的原因可以分为以下几类:

### 1. 网络问题

网络问题是导致云服务器连接超时的最常见原因之一。可能的网络问题包括:

– **网络延迟**:由于网络路径长或路由不佳,导致数据包传输时间过长,从而引发连接超时。
– **丢包**:网络不稳定或带宽不足会导致数据包的丢失,造成连接中断。
– **DNS解析问题**:DNS服务器响应慢或配置错误,会导致无法解析云服务器的域名,从而无法建立连接。

### 2. 服务器负载

云服务器的负载过高也可能会导致连接超时。尤其是当同时有大量用户访问时,服务器可能无法及时响应请求,导致连接超时。常见的表现包括:

– **CPU、内存使用率过高**:服务器资源被占满,不再处理新的连接请求。
– **磁盘I/O瓶颈**:数据读取和写入受到阻碍,导致请求处理延迟。

### 3. 安全设置

服务器的安全设置,如防火墙或安全组的规则,可能会阻止连接。这可能引发以下问题:

– **防火墙规则**:未开放必要的端口,导致连接请求被阻止。
– **IP地址黑名单**:由于某些原因,某些IP地址被列入黑名单,无法访问服务器。

### 4. 应用程序问题

有时,连接超时可能与应用程序的配置或性能有关。原因包括:

– **应用程序崩溃**:应用程序因错误而崩溃,无法响应用户请求。
– **超时设置不当**:应用程序的超时设置不合理,导致正常请求也被视为超时。

## 二、如何排查云服务器连接超时的问题

当遇到连接超时时,我们需要进行系统的排查,以找出问题的根源。以下是一些常用的排查步骤:

### 1. 检查网络连接

首先要确认您本地的网络是否正常,与云服务器的连接是否畅通。可以使用以下方法进行检查:

– **ping 命令**:通过执行 `ping ` 来判断云服务器是否可达。若无响应,则可能是网络问题。
– **traceroute 命令**:使用 `traceroute `(在Windows上是 `tracert`)来追踪数据包的路由情况,判断是否存在延迟或丢包。

### 2. 查看服务器状态

确认云服务器是否正常运行。您可以通过云服务提供商的管理控制台检查实例的状态。请注意以下几点:

– **CPU和内存使用情况**:查看资源监控,确认是否资源被耗尽。
– **磁盘状态**:确保磁盘没有出现故障,I/O性能正常。

### 3. 检查安全设置

如果网络和服务器状态正常,接下来需要检查安全设置:

– **防火墙规则**:登录服务器后,检查防火墙规则是否正确开放了必要的端口。
– **安全组配置**:登录云服务管理平台,确保安全组规则允许正确的IP访问。

### 4. 检查应用程序日志

如果以上步骤未发现问题,您需要检查应用程序的日志文件。诊断应用程序时可以关注以下信息:

– **错误信息**:查看是否有异常或错误信息,可能是应用崩溃的原因。
– **超时设置**:确认应用程序的连接超时设置是否合理,必要时可进行调整。

## 三、解决云服务器连接超时的问题

根据排查结果,可以采取相应的解决方案:

### 1. 优化网络

如果问题出在网络方面,可以考虑以下优化措施:

– **更换ISP**:选择质量更高的网络服务提供商,确保网络稳定性。
– **CDN加速**:使用内容分发网络(CDN)将内容缓存到离用户更近的节点,减少延迟。

### 2. 增加服务器资源

当负载过高导致超时时,可以通过增加服务器的资源来解决:

– **升级实例规格**:根据你的需求,选择更高性能的服务器规格。
– **负载均衡**:通过设置负载均衡,将流量分配到多台实例上,提高并发处理能力。

### 3. 调整安全设置

为了解决因安全设置导致的超时问题,您可以:

– **修改防火墙规则**:确保开放正常访问的端口。
– **解除IP限制**:若已将用户IP列入黑名单,需将其移除。

### 4. 优化应用程序

如果应用程序本身出现问题,您可以采取以下方案进行优化:

– **代码审查与优化**:分析代码性能瓶颈,优化算法,提高处理速率。
– **优化数据库查询**:减少不必要的查询,使用索引提升查询效率。

## 四、预防云服务器连接超时

为了避免未来出现连接超时的问题,建议采取以下预防措施:

### 1. 定期监控

定期对云服务器的性能进行监控,及时发现潜在问题。可以使用云服务商提供的监控工具或者第三方监控软件,对CPU、内存、网络流量及磁盘使用情况进行跟踪。

### 2. 定期维护

对云服务器进行定期维护,包括清理不必要的文件、更新应用程序和系统补丁,确保系统性能处于最佳状态。

### 3. 安全设置审计

定期审计防火墙和安全组设置,确保它们符合最佳实践,同时保证服务器的安全。

### 4. 应用程序的负载测试

在上线之前,进行严格的负载测试,模拟高并发用户访问情况,确保应用能够承受预期的流量。

## 五、总结

云服务器连接超时是一个常见问题,但通过系统的排查和合理的解决方案,能够有效应对并减少此类问题的发生。用户应增强对云服务器的监控和维护,确保其稳定性和可靠性,进而提升业务的网站和应用的可用性。希望本文能够为广大云服务器用户提供有价值的参考,让大家在遇到连接超时时能够从容应对。

以上就是小编关于“云服务器连接超时怎么办”的分享和介绍

三五互联(35.com)是经工信部、ICANN、CNNIC认证的全球顶级域名注册服务机构,是中国五星级域名注册商!有超过2000万个域名通过三五互联注册并管理,超过100万个网站托管在三五互联云服务器和虚拟主机三五互联支持数十个顶级域名的注册与管理,支持批量查询、批量注册、批量解析、智能解析、批量过户等便捷好用的功能,拥有非常好的使用体验。
目前,三五互联域名注册正在特价,最低仅需1元!
更多详情请见:https://www.35.com/services/domain/

三五互联域名抢注预定,支持抢注各类高价值老域名,支持“建站历史、百度收录、百度权重、历史外链、百度评价、搜狗反链”等数十项综合检索功能!!可快速精准定位到您想要定位到的各类精品域名!同时,三五互联域名抢注集成了全球多个抢注商(近200个抢注商,还将陆续增加),整理出10多条抢注通道,从根本上提升了抢注成功率!
其中,1号通道,实测抢注成功率高达99% 。每天三五互联预释放功能还会释放若干优质过期域名,可以直接抢注竞拍。
赶紧预订抢注心仪的优质域名吧:https://www.35.com/booking/

赞(0)
声明:本网站发布的内容(图片、视频和文字)以原创、转载和分享网络内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。邮箱:3140448839@qq.com。本站原创内容未经允许不得转载,或转载时需注明出处:三五互联知识库 » 云服务器连接超时怎么办

登录

找回密码

注册